22 [MANUSCRIPT - MUSIC - GUITAR]. LABORDE, Jean Benjamin de.
Recueil d'airs avec accompagnement & guittare par Mr. de Laborde.
[France, 2nd half of the 18th century]. Oblong 4to (20.5 x 26.5). Contemporary richly gold-tooled red morocco, with gilt edges and silk endleaves. With decorated title-page and half-title, pages with hand-coloured wood-engraved floral border, songs, music notation (including both regular notes and tablature) in neat manuscript with gilt decorations and initials and title calligraphed in gold. [1, 2 blank], 152, [1 blank] pp. Full description >>

23 [SERRE des RIEUX, Jean de].
Les dons des enfans de Latone: la musique et la chasse du cerf, poëmes dédiés au Roy.
Paris, Pierre Prault, Jean Desaint & Jacques Guerin (who also printed the book), 1734. 8vo. Contemporary mottled calf, spine gilt in compartments with red title label lettered in gold, marbled endpapers, red painted edges. With engraved frontispiece by Le Bas, 6 full-page engravings by Le Bas after Oudry, illustrating the poem 'Diane' (p. 147-272, one of which is the frontispiece with hunting scene), and 50 pp. with engraved text and musical notation.
